Botswana Gears Up for NextGen Tourism Business Expo 2025. The countdown has begun for the highly anticipated NextGen Tourism Business Expo 2025, with just three days to go before the event opens its doors at the Protea Hotel by Marriott in Gaborone from 2–3 October.

The Expo is set to convene entrepreneurs, investors, policymakers, and innovators to explore fresh opportunities shaping Botswana’s tourism sector. With tourism being a key driver of economic diversification, the event offers a timely platform for businesses to exchange ideas, forge partnerships, and identify new markets.

Participants can expect two days of interactive discussions, networking sessions, and exhibitions focused on redefining Botswana’s tourism landscape. The agenda is designed to address the evolving needs of the industry, highlighting technology adoption, sustainable tourism models, and investment-ready projects that can stimulate growth across the value chain.

For Botswana’s entrepreneurs, particularly those in small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s), the Expo provides a chance to showcase services and products while connecting with potential partners. The presence of business leaders and stakeholders from across the tourism ecosystem is expected to create an enabling environment for collaboration.

The timing of the Expo comes as the global tourism sector continues its recovery and reinvention, opening opportunities for countries like Botswana to position themselves competitively. Beyond its natural attractions, Botswana’s tourism sector is expanding to include cultural tourism, eco-tourism, and community-based models—all of which require fresh thinking and entrepreneurial input.

With the event only days away, expectations are high that the NextGen Tourism Business Expo 2025 will spark bold conversations and lay the groundwork for future-focused strategies in one of Botswana’s most vital industries.
